Developing Predictive Models: Algorithmic Strategies
The burgeoning field of data science heavily relies on building predictive models, and these are fundamentally rooted in algorithmic perspectives. Utilizing machine learning techniques, we can analyze historical data to anticipate future outcomes with surprising accuracy. This involves a multifaceted process, starting with data gathering and meticulous purification. Algorithms, ranging from simple linear modeling to complex neural networks, are then opted for and rigorously trained on the data. Feature engineering—the art of selecting and transforming variables—plays a crucial role in improving model performance. Finally, rigorous assessment and ongoing tracking are vital to ensure the model remains reliable and adapts to changing conditions.
